Fascia Painting in Boulder, CO
Fascia painting services involve applying fresh paint to the horizontal boards that run along the edges of a roofline, providing both aesthetic appeal and protection against the elements. This project is often requested during home exterior updates or repairs, especially when the fascia has become weathered, chipped, or faded over time. Property owners typically want to know about the types of paint suitable for outdoor conditions, the preparation process needed to ensure a smooth finish, and how to select colors that complement the overall appearance of their home.
Before requesting fascia painting, homeowners should consider the current condition of the existing surface, including any signs of rot, peeling paint, or damage that might require additional repairs.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of the project, such as whether the fascia needs cleaning, sanding, or priming before painting. Proper preparation can help achieve a long-lasting finish, making it a key aspect of planning for fascia painting projects on residential properties.

Fascia Painting Questions
What is fascia painting? Fascia painting involves applying fresh paint to the horizontal boards along the roofline, improving appearance and protecting against weather damage.
Why should fascia be painted? Painting fascia helps prevent wood rot, extends its lifespan, and enhances the overall look of a property’s exterior.
What types of projects typically require fascia painting? Fascia painting is common during home renovations, repainting exteriors, or when replacing damaged or worn-out fascia boards.
What should property owners consider before painting fascia? It's important to inspect for damage, choose appropriate weather-resistant paint, and ensure proper surface preparation for lasting results.
